I watched one the other night that was just hilarious. It was called Monster Man. Not a real creative title, not did it really go well with the plot but the movie is worth watching if you enjoy cheesy horror flicks.



The basic premise is two guys heading through the south (inbred areas) so that the main character can tell some chick he loves her before he gets married. His sidekick is your usual loud and obnoxious friend who will sit in a diner and piss off the locals. Well on their way down the road they get harassed by a unknown person is a hilarious looking monster truck.



They eventually get run off the road by the truck as it vanishes down the road. Later on they stop at a gas station. As the main guy takes a piss the monster truck pulls up and he heads to the restroom. As he is in there the obnoxious guy takes a piss inside the truck as the main guy gets a good look at the "monster".

Later they pick up a beautiful blonde who seems to be attracted to the main guy despite the advances of the obnoxious guy.

I won't spoil the ending but it gets pretty gory by the end.

What I found odd though about this movie was this. For the first half they really tried hard not to have foul language. They used "A-Hole" all movie even though the movie was rated R. Sure there was gore but they seemed to never swear, except once. And the sex scene was fully clothed. Just odd I thought. So if you get a chance to see this, do so.
